LIBCO SYSTEMS LTD
Computers-hardware & Maintenance
P.O.Box: 185-00100 Nairobi Nairobi
Afya Centre, 1st Flr, Tom Mboya St, Nairobi
(254) 202223920




On the map (Click to expand)